Yep that is what I am saying. Lets say you have a flight plan. Lets call it from KORD to KJFK with waypoints A-B-C-D for simplicity. On the legs page it would look like

1L SLK   A

2L SLK   B
3L SLK   C

4L SLK   D.

 

Lets say ATC issues you a clearance like "Descend to FL280, be level 40 miles from B. So you would simply input B/-40 into 2L LSK. Then execute. You would now have a waypoint 40 miles before you reach B at the 2L LSK line. Then of course you would enter 280 in the scratchpad and put it into the 2R LSK and execute. Now if you were in VNAV and had 280 set in the MCP then plane would cross 40 miles before B at FL280
